A year is the time it takes to orbit the Sun. Mercury is nearer to the Sun, so it takes it less time to to make one complete orbit of the Sun. Earth takes just over 365 days to orbit the Sun so that is the length of a year on Earth. The year of all the planets are different lengths.A year is the time it takes to orbit the Sun. The Moon doesn't directly orbit the Sun - it orbits the Earth. As the Moon is orbiting the Earth and it takes the Earth 365.26 days to orbit the Sun then that's how long it takes for the Moon (and the Earth of course) to go all the way around. It just does it orbiting us.
It takes Earth 1 year to orbit the Sun. It takes Pluto 248 years to do the same. The time depends on the distance from the sun and, therefore, the length of the orbit.

It takes Earth about 365 Earth days to orbit the sun. It takes Mars about 687 Earth days to orbit the sun. This means it takes Mars about 1.88 times longer to orbit the sun than Earth.
